YEREVAN. - The share of information technologies in Armenia’s GDP reached 5% which is equal to mining industry, Prime Minister Tigran Sargsyan said at a conference with Armenian businessmen from Diaspora.

Both spheres have 5,000 employees but the wages in IT field are higher, he said.  

“The main resource for IT is intellect so we have placed emphasis on education,” Tigran Sargsyan added.

He pointed out math school which is one of the best among the CIS states. Prime Minister promised to draw much attention to university education to preserve traditions of math school in Armenia.
